Form 4: TaskUs Director Jill A. Greenthal Reports Stock Vesting

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4 Filing


Director Jill A. Greenthal reports the vesting of restricted stock units (RSUs) convertible to Class A common stock in TaskUs, Inc.

Summary

  • On April 1, 2024, TaskUs, Inc. Director Jill A. Greenthal reported the vesting of 2,420 restricted stock units (RSUs) which convert into Class A common stock.
  • Following the transaction, Greenthal directly owns 13,314 shares of Class A common stock and 2,494 RSUs.
  • The RSUs vest annually over three years: 33% vested on April 1, 2023, 33% on April 1, 2024, and the remaining 34% will vest on April 1, 2025.
  • Greenthal has granted power of attorney to Claudia Walsh, Balaji Sekar, Steven Amaya, Scott Andreasen, and Garrett Gold to handle SEC filings related to TaskUs securities.
